Find LCM of 646,218,627,869 with Prime Factorization
2 | 646, 218, 627, 869 |
11 | 323, 109, 627, 869 |
19 | 323, 109, 57, 79 |
17, 109, 3, 79 |
Multiply the prime numbers at the bottom and the left side.
2 x 11 x 19 x 17 x 109 x 3 x 79 = 183569298
Therefore, the lowest common multiple of 646,218,627,869 is 183569298.
